Abstract

Faraday rotation measurement is used in conjunction with dual comb spectroscopy with Fabry-Perot quantum cascade lasers at 8 μm. The lasers have a spectral resolution on the order of 10 kHz while the measurement spectrum covers over 80 wavenumbers.
